If you’re used to traveling with amenities like showers, laundry, and sometimes even fireplaces, a Class A motorhome is going to suit you well. If you want to travel lighter, and with just one or two other people, a Class B campervan might be more your style - the smaller size means it’s easier to maneuver and you can camp just about anywhere. A Class C camper is the perfect blend of both of those classes - larger than a campervan, but with some of the amenities of a Class A motorhome. Amherst is a small town located in Lorain County, Ohio. It has a population of around 12,000 people and offers visitors a glimpse into the area's rich history. Amherst Beaver Creek Reservation is a beautiful nature park that covers over 400 acres and features hiking trails, picnic areas, fishing spots, and playgrounds. The park is open year-round and is an excellent place to take a break from driving and enjoy the natural beauty of this part of Ohio.If you're interested in learning about local history, then be sure to visit the Amherst Historical Society. The museum contains exhibits on the town's founding in 1811 and displays on local industries like sandstone quarrying. Guided tours are available for groups of ten or more.The Lorain Harbor Lighthouse was built in 1917 and was a beacon for ships entering the harbor for over 60 years. Today it stands as a reminder of Lorain's maritime history and is open for tours during the summer months.

Popular State Parks Near Amherst, OH

East Harbor State Park in Ottawa County, Ohio, offers a range of recreational activities for RV travelers. The park is perfect for an extended stay, featuring over 500 electric campsites and amenities such as showers, flush toilets, and laundry facilities. You can also explore hiking trails or picnic with your loved ones.Kelleys Island State Park is located on Kelleys Island in Ohio and was established in 1956. The park covers an area of 676 acres with a variety of camping options available for RVers. There are 129 electric campsites available with amenities, including shower houses, flush toilets, picnic tables, fire rings, and playgrounds. You can hike on one of the many trails or take advantage of the beach, which has swimming areas with lifeguards during summer.Findley State Park in Lorain County, Ohio, offers visitors excellent opportunities to hike or bike through scenic woodland trails. The park has 254 electric campsites available for RVers, along with amenities such as restrooms, showers, picnic tables, and fire pits.
